特有的数据库包括什么

worktile 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    特有的数据库包括以下几种:

    1. 关系型数据库(RDBMS):关系型数据库是最常见的数据库类型,使用表格结构来存储和管理数据。其中最著名的是Oracle、MySQL和Microsoft SQL Server等。

    2. 非关系型数据库(NoSQL):非关系型数据库是一种灵活的数据库类型,不使用固定的表格结构,而是使用键值对、文档、列族或图形等不同的数据模型。其中最著名的是MongoDB、Cassandra和Redis等。

    3. 图数据库:图数据库是专门用于处理图形数据的数据库类型,它使用节点和边的方式来表示数据之间的关系。图数据库可以高效地进行复杂的图形操作和查询,最著名的图数据库是Neo4j。

    4. 文档数据库:文档数据库是一种非关系型数据库,它以类似于JSON的文档格式存储数据。文档数据库可以存储不同结构的数据,并支持灵活的查询和索引。MongoDB是最常用的文档数据库。

    5. 列式数据库:列式数据库是一种关系型数据库的变体,它以列的方式存储数据,而不是以行的方式存储。列式数据库适用于大规模数据分析和查询,最著名的列式数据库是Apache HBase和Google Bigtable。

    这些特有的数据库类型都有各自的特点和适用场景,根据具体的需求和数据类型,选择合适的数据库类型可以提高数据管理和查询的效率。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    特有的数据库指的是一些具有特殊功能或特殊用途的数据库系统。下面列举了一些常见的特有数据库:

    1. TimescaleDB:TimescaleDB是一个用于处理时间序列数据的开源数据库。它在传统关系型数据库的基础上进行了扩展,提供了更高效的数据存储和查询能力,特别适用于大规模的时间序列数据分析和处理。

    2. InfluxDB:InfluxDB是一个专门用于存储和分析时间序列数据的开源数据库。它具有高性能和可扩展性,支持快速的数据写入和灵活的查询操作,可以广泛应用于物联网、监控系统和实时分析等领域。

    3. Cassandra:Cassandra是一个高度可扩展的分布式数据库系统,具有高性能和高可用性。它采用了分布式架构和无中心节点的设计,可以处理大规模的数据集和高并发的访问请求,适用于分布式存储和大数据处理场景。

    4. Redis:Redis是一个基于内存的键值存储系统,具有高性能和低延迟的特点。它支持多种数据结构,如字符串、列表、哈希表等,并提供了丰富的操作命令,可以用于缓存、消息队列、计数器等多种应用场景。

    5. Neo4j:Neo4j是一个图数据库,专门用于存储和处理图形数据。它采用了图形模型和图算法,可以高效地处理复杂的关系和查询操作,适用于社交网络分析、推荐系统和知识图谱等领域。

    6. MongoDB:MongoDB是一个面向文档的NoSQL数据库,支持动态的数据模型和灵活的查询操作。它适用于大规模数据存储和实时数据处理,具有高性能和可扩展性。

    以上是一些常见的特有数据库,它们在不同的场景和需求下具有各自的特点和优势,可以根据具体的业务需求选择适合的数据库系统。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    特有的数据库包括关系型数据库、非关系型数据库和图形数据库。以下将对这三种数据库进行详细介绍。

    一、关系型数据库
    关系型数据库是最常见的数据库类型之一,它使用表格来存储数据,并使用事先定义好的关系来连接不同的表格。关系型数据库具有以下特点:

    1. 结构化:数据以表格的形式进行组织,每个表格都有特定的列和行来存储数据。
    2. 使用SQL查询语言:关系型数据库使用结构化查询语言(SQL)来操作和查询数据。
    3. 数据一致性:关系型数据库使用事务来确保数据的一致性和完整性。
    4. 支持复杂查询:关系型数据库可以进行复杂的查询操作,如联合、嵌套和聚合查询。

    常见的关系型数据库包括:

    1. Oracle:一种功能强大的关系型数据库管理系统(RDBMS),广泛应用于企业级应用。
    2. MySQL:一种开源的关系型数据库管理系统,被广泛用于Web应用开发。
    3. SQL Server:由Microsoft开发的关系型数据库管理系统,适用于Windows平台。
    4. PostgreSQL:一种开源的关系型数据库管理系统,具有高度可扩展性和安全性。

    二、非关系型数据库
    非关系型数据库,也被称为NoSQL数据库,采用了不同的数据模型来存储和检索数据,不使用表格和SQL查询语言。非关系型数据库具有以下特点:

    1. 非结构化:数据以键值对、文档、列族或图形等形式存储,没有固定的表格结构。
    2. 高可扩展性:非关系型数据库可以轻松扩展以处理大规模数据。
    3. 高性能:非关系型数据库具有快速的读写性能,适用于大量数据的高并发访问。

    常见的非关系型数据库包括:

    1. MongoDB:一种基于文档模型的非关系型数据库,适用于大规模数据存储和处理。
    2. Redis:一种开源的键值存储数据库,具有高速读写和缓存功能。
    3. Cassandra:一种分布式的列族数据库,适用于大规模数据的高可扩展性和高可用性。

    三、图形数据库
    图形数据库是一种特殊的数据库类型,用于存储和处理图形数据,如节点和边。它使用图形结构来表示数据之间的关系,并支持复杂的图形查询。图形数据库具有以下特点:

    1. 图形结构:数据以节点和边的形式存储,节点表示实体,边表示实体之间的关系。
    2. 灵活的查询:图形数据库支持复杂的图形查询,如查找关联节点和路径等。
    3. 高性能:图形数据库使用高效的图形遍历算法来实现快速的查询。

    常见的图形数据库包括:

    1. Neo4j:一种开源的图形数据库,具有高度可扩展性和灵活的图形查询功能。
    2. Amazon Neptune:亚马逊提供的托管图形数据库,适用于构建高性能的图形应用程序。

    综上所述,特有的数据库包括关系型数据库、非关系型数据库和图形数据库。每种数据库类型都有其特定的用途和优势,根据实际需求选择适合的数据库类型可以提高数据存储和查询的效率。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部